In April, the sucker fish returns to spawn after travelling to the spirit realm to receive cleansing techniques for this world. As it swims through the water, it purifies a path for the spirits and cleanses the water beings. As life bursts forth within the stream and along its banks, we are reminded that we are but partners in this experience called life—that the harmony within the stream can also exist within ourselves. Once we discover this and are healed, we can bring healing to others through our peaceful presence and actions.

Design:
Algonquin artist Frank Polson has created a captivating image of a full moon filling the sky as it sits low on the horizon behind a leafless tree. To the left, a sucker fish swims downward, away from the viewer, along the edge of the coin. A trail of bubbles forms in the wake of its tail as the fish turns towards the tree on the right. The use of bold lines, and the insertion of vivid colour within black areas as if to reveal what lies within, is a signature design element in woodland art.
